Principais editores de HTML que todo desenvolvedor web deve conhecer

Publicados: 2024-07-08

O desenvolvimento da Web já percorreu um longo caminho desde os primeiros dias da codificação manual de cada linha de HTML em um editor de texto básico. Vários editores HTML estão disponíveis hoje, oferecendo recursos e ferramentas avançadas para agilizar o processo de codificação, melhorar a produtividade e melhorar a experiência geral de desenvolvimento. Uma das últimas tendências é a capacidade de converter designs de Figma para HTML sem problemas.

Neste artigo, exploraremos os 10 principais editores de HTML para desenvolvimento web, destacando seus principais recursos, vantagens e por que eles se destacam no concorrido campo de ferramentas de desenvolvimento.

Código

1. Código do Visual Studio

O Visual Studio Code (VS Code) rapidamente se tornou o editor de código preferido para muitos desenvolvedores da web. Desenvolvido pela Microsoft, este editor de código aberto é conhecido por sua flexibilidade, desempenho e ecossistema robusto de extensões.

Características principais:

IntelliSense: oferece preenchimento inteligente de código com base em tipos de variáveis, definições de funções e módulos importados.

Mercado de extensões: Milhares de extensões estão disponíveis para adicionar funcionalidades como linters, depuradores e temas.

Terminal integrado: permite que os desenvolvedores executem ferramentas de linha de comando diretamente no editor.

Integração Git: Suporte integrado para Git, tornando o controle de versão fácil e contínuo.

Por que se destaca:

A popularidade do VS Code deriva de seus recursos poderosos e capacidade de personalização, atendendo a desenvolvedores iniciantes e avançados. As atualizações constantes e uma comunidade forte fazem dele uma ferramenta em constante evolução.

2. Texto Sublime

Sublime Text é um editor de código altamente conceituado, conhecido por sua velocidade e interface minimalista. Ele suporta muitas linguagens de programação, incluindo HTML, e é preferido por sua simplicidade e desempenho.

Características principais:

Ir para qualquer coisa: navega rapidamente para arquivos, símbolos ou linhas com apenas algumas teclas.

Múltiplas Seleções: Permite a edição simultânea, permitindo que os desenvolvedores façam alterações em várias linhas de uma só vez.

Paleta de Comandos: Acesse funcionalidades usadas com frequência sem navegar nos menus.

Extensibilidade: Suporta plug-ins para recursos adicionais e personalização.

Por que se destaca:

A eficiência e o design leve do Sublime Text o tornam uma excelente escolha para desenvolvedores que priorizam velocidade e um ambiente de codificação sem distrações.

3. Átomo

Atom, desenvolvido pelo GitHub, é um editor de código aberto projetado para ser profundamente personalizável. Ele tem uma aparência moderna e sua flexibilidade o torna um favorito entre os desenvolvedores que gostam de ajustar suas ferramentas.

Características principais:

Teletype: Permite colaboração em tempo real, permitindo que vários desenvolvedores trabalhem no mesmo projeto simultaneamente.

Temas e Personalização: Amplas opções de personalização com uma variedade de temas e pacotes.

Preenchimento automático inteligente: ajuda na codificação mais rápida com sugestões de código inteligentes.

Navegador do sistema de arquivos: Fácil navegação e organização dos arquivos do projeto.

Por que se destaca:

Os recursos de hackabilidade e colaboração do Atom, juntamente com seu design elegante, tornam-no uma escolha atraente para equipes e indivíduos.

4. Colchetes

Brackets é um editor HTML de código aberto desenvolvido pela Adobe, adaptado especificamente para web design e desenvolvimento front-end. Ele oferece um recurso de visualização ao vivo que é particularmente útil para web designers.

Características principais:

Visualização ao vivo: exibe atualizações em tempo real no navegador conforme você codifica.

Suporte a pré-processador: Inclui suporte para pré-processadores como LESS e SCSS.

Editores Inline: Permitem a edição de CSS, JavaScript e HTML sem alternar entre arquivos.

Gerenciador de extensões: estenda facilmente a funcionalidade com uma ampla variedade de extensões.

Por que se destaca:

A visualização ao vivo e o suporte ao pré-processador do Brackets o tornam ideal para desenvolvedores front-end e designers que precisam de feedback instantâneo sobre suas alterações.

5. Bloco de notas++

Notepad++ é um editor de código-fonte aberto gratuito que tem sido uma referência na comunidade de desenvolvedores há anos. É leve, rápido e oferece suporte a várias linguagens de programação, incluindo HTML.

Características principais:

Realce e dobramento de sintaxe: ajuda na melhor legibilidade e organização do código.

Gravação e reprodução de macros: automatiza tarefas repetitivas gravando e executando macros.

Interface Multi-Documentos: Permite trabalhar em vários arquivos simultaneamente.

Plugins: Suporta uma ampla variedade de plugins para funcionalidade adicional.

Por que se destaca:

O Notepad++ é conhecido por sua simplicidade e desempenho. Sua natureza leve o torna perfeito para edições rápidas e pequenos projetos.

6. Adobe Dreamweaver

Adobe Dreamweaver é uma ferramenta profissional de desenvolvimento web que oferece um conjunto abrangente de recursos para projetar, codificar e gerenciar sites. Ele suporta edição visual e baseada em código.

Características principais:

Editor WYSIWYG: Permite desenhar páginas web visualmente, o que é útil para designers.

Introspecção de código: oferece dicas e conclusão de código para uma codificação mais rápida.

Ferramentas de design responsivo: Ajuda na criação de sites responsivos com facilidade.

Integração com produtos Adobe: integra-se perfeitamente com outras ferramentas da Adobe Creative Cloud.

Por que se destaca:

A interface dupla do Dreamweaver, voltada para designers e desenvolvedores, juntamente com sua integração com o ecossistema da Adobe, o torna uma ferramenta poderosa para desenvolvimento web profissional.

7. WebStorm

WebStorm, desenvolvido pela JetBrains, é um IDE poderoso projetado especificamente para desenvolvimento de JavaScript. Ele também oferece suporte robusto para HTML, CSS e outras tecnologias da web.

Características principais:

Assistência de codificação inteligente: fornece conclusão de código inteligente, detecção de erros em tempo real e navegação poderosa.

Depurador integrado: inclui um depurador poderoso para JavaScript, Node.js e HTML.

Controle de versão: suporta Git, GitHub, Mercurial e outros VCS.

Teste: Ferramentas integradas para testes unitários e integração com estruturas de testes populares.

Por que se destaca:

O conjunto abrangente de recursos do WebStorm, adaptados para desenvolvimento web, o torna um favorito entre os desenvolvedores profissionais que precisam de ferramentas avançadas e recursos de depuração.

8. Edição Komodo

Komodo Edit é um editor gratuito e de código aberto que oferece funcionalidades básicas para desenvolvimento web. Sua simplicidade e facilidade de uso o tornam adequado para iniciantes e para quem trabalha em projetos menores.

Características principais:

Suporte multilíngue: Suporta HTML, CSS, JavaScript e muitos outros idiomas.

Destaque de sintaxe: melhora a legibilidade e a organização do código.

Extensões e complementos: Amplie a funcionalidade com uma variedade de complementos disponíveis.

Inteligência de código: fornece conclusão de código e verificação de sintaxe.

Por que se destaca:

A abordagem direta do Komodo Edit e o suporte para vários idiomas o tornam uma boa escolha para desenvolvedores que procuram um editor HTML simples, mas funcional.

9. Peixe azul

Bluefish é um editor poderoso e de código aberto voltado para o desenvolvimento web. Ele oferece uma ampla gama de recursos e suporta diversas linguagens de programação, tornando-o versátil para diversas tarefas de desenvolvimento.

Características principais:

Rápido e Leve: Desempenho eficiente mesmo em grandes projetos.

Gerenciamento de projetos: Fácil manuseio de vários projetos com um recurso de gerenciamento de projetos.

Snippets: insira rapidamente trechos de código comumente usados.

Corretor ortográfico: ajuda a manter a qualidade do conteúdo das páginas da web.

Por que se destaca:

A velocidade e o extenso conjunto de recursos do Bluefish, combinados com sua natureza de código aberto, tornam-no uma excelente escolha para desenvolvedores que procuram um editor HTML gratuito, mas poderoso.

10. Café expresso

Espresso é um editor HTML exclusivo para Mac, conhecido por sua bela interface e recursos poderosos. Ele foi projetado para agilizar o fluxo de trabalho de desenvolvedores e designers web.

Características principais:

Visualização ao vivo: atualizações instantâneas no navegador conforme você codifica.

Ferramentas de edição CSS: ferramentas avançadas para edição CSS, incluindo edição e visualização em tempo real.

Sincronização: sincroniza projetos com servidores sem esforço.

Espaço de trabalho: organiza projetos e arquivos em um espaço de trabalho intuitivo.

Por que se destaca:

O design e a funcionalidade do Espresso, adaptados especificamente para macOS, fazem dele uma escolha de destaque para usuários de Mac que desejam um ambiente de codificação elegante e eficiente.

11. Zed.dev

Zed.dev é um editor de código moderno que oferece um ambiente de codificação sem distrações, ao mesmo tempo que fornece recursos poderosos para um desenvolvimento eficiente. Ele foi projetado com foco na velocidade e uma abordagem minimalista, tornando-o uma opção atraente para desenvolvedores que preferem uma interface limpa.

Características principais:

Interface sem distrações: Design minimalista que foca no código com menos distrações.

Desempenho rápido: otimizado para velocidade, garantindo edição suave e responsiva mesmo com arquivos grandes.

Ferramentas de desenvolvimento integradas: ferramentas integradas para depuração, teste e controle de versão.

Recursos colaborativos: Suporta colaboração em tempo real, permitindo que vários desenvolvedores trabalhem na mesma base de código simultaneamente.

Por que se destaca:

A ênfase do Zed.dev em uma interface limpa e sem distrações, combinada com poderosas ferramentas de desenvolvimento, torna-o uma escolha única para desenvolvedores que buscam eficiência e simplicidade.

Conclusão

Escolher o editor HTML certo pode impactar significativamente seu fluxo de trabalho e produtividade de desenvolvimento web. Quer você prefira um editor leve como o Sublime Text ou um IDE rico em recursos como o WebStorm, o segredo é encontrar uma ferramenta que atenda às suas necessidades e preferências específicas.

Cada um dos editores listados aqui possui pontos fortes únicos, tornando-os adequados para diferentes tipos de projetos e desenvolvedores. Ao explorar essas opções, você encontrará o editor HTML perfeito para melhorar sua experiência de desenvolvimento web. Se precisar de mais experiência, você pode contratar desenvolvedores de HTML para ajudá-lo a aproveitar ao máximo essas ferramentas e garantir que seus projetos sejam de primeira linha.